U.S. Army Military District of Washington and Joint Task Force- National Capital Region Commander Maj. Gen. Antoinette Gant presents a challenge coin to Lorenzen Baker of the Directorate of Human Resources. Baker serves as the Casualty Memorial Affairs Coordinator, where his attention to detail and selfless dedication consistently proves he is a valued team member. He has managed more than 1600 plane side and military funeral honors for the Fort Meade area of responsibility over the last six months.
On May 5, 2026, U.S. Army Military District of Washington and Joint Task Force- National Capital Region Commander Maj. Gen. Antoinette Gant visited Fort Meade to recognize members of Team Meade for their excellence. During her visit, she learned more about the 2d Military Working Dog (MWD) Detachment mission.
